On focal length

The picture angle of this camera is narrower than that of a 35 mm-format
camera. You can find the approximate equivalent of the focal length of a
35 mm-format camera, and shoot with the same picture angle, by increasing
the focal length of your lens by half.
For example, by using a 50 mm lens, you can get the approximate equivalent
of a 75 mm lens of a 35 mm-format camera.
